They Were Five (1936)

Five unemployed workers win 100,000 Francs in the national lottery. Instead of sharing the money, they buy a ruin and build an open-air cafe. But difficulties come to split their friendly group apart.  (more)

DIRECTION:  Julien Duvivier
CAST:  Jean Gabin  •  Charles Vanel  •  Viviane Romance  •  Charles Dorat

Monte Cristo (1929)

This epic adaptation of The Count of Monte Cristo was directed by Henri Fescourt, and stars Jean Angelo, Lil Dagover, Pierre Batcheff, the beautiful Marie Glory, and Bernhard Goetzke as the Abbé Faria.  (more)

DIRECTION:  Henri Fescourt
CAST:  Jean Angelo  •  Lil Dagover  •  Gaston Modot  •  Jean Toulout

The Chocolate Girl (1932)

A bureaucratic civil servant is annoyed by the spoiled daughter of a rich chocolate maker, but lands up marrying her.  (more)

DIRECTION:  Marc Allégret
CAST:  Raimu  •  Jacqueline Francell  •  Michèle Verly  •  Simone Simon

The Lady of Lebanon (1934)

The French and the English spy on each other, in this adventure set in post World War I colonial Syria.  (more)

DIRECTION:  Jean Epstein
CAST:  Spinelly  •  Jean Murat  •  George Grossmith  •  Marguerite Templey

L'Embuscade (1941)

A young man is hired by an industrialist, while a secret hangs over his birth. His boss's wife turns out to be his mother, who hides the truth from him.  (more)

DIRECTION:  Fernand Rivers
CAST:  Pierre Renoir  •  Valentine Tessier  •  Jules Berry  •  Raymond Aimos

Belphégor (1927)

Belphégor deals with a series of mysterious appearances by a masked-and-robed figure in the Louvre; a security guard is murdered, and a later police trap is foiled when the phantom—“Belphégor” (the name of a legendary demon)—uses knock-out gas. Journalist Jacques ...  (more)

DIRECTION:  Henri Desfontaines
CAST:  René Navarre  •  Elmire Vautier  •  Lucien Dalsace  •  Michèle Verly
